The "Air Jordan 11 Low" is perfect for casual collectors, or if you just want one reliable, stylish pair. It’s a sneaker you won't get tired of. At ~$200, it's an investment in a versatile wardrobe staple. Conversely, if you're seeking max comfort or a true modern basketball shoe... look elsewhere. The cushioning tech here is dated. Also, if you have a wider foot, the fit might be snug. I'd say the "Air Jordan 11 Low" is about 70% style, 30% sport. You're buying the iconic look first and foremost. Comparing it to other Jordans – versus an Air Jordan 1, the 11 Low is way more comfortable for long periods. Compared to its high-top sibling, it's less restrictive. The main advantage here is versatility. You get that legendary 11 aesthetic – the patent leather mudguard, the carbon fiber – but in a package that's easier to wear daily. It's a different vibe, for sure. On-feet, this "Air Jordan 11 Low "Cool Grey"" just pops on camera—the light hits the patent leather so nicely! It’s a versatile color that goes with almost everything. However... the outsole picks up dust "like crazy" on hard floors. It's a minor gripe, but worth noting! For "$225", you're paying for that iconic "Jordan series" heritage and a timeless design. If you love the 11’s silhouette but want a less bulky option, this is it. Not for folks who hate cleaning their soles, though!
